**14:32 — Crash-report pipeline degradation (Fernhollow Mobile)**

Ingestion lag on the Fernhollow crash-report pipeline crossed the 20-minute threshold. The symbolication workers were starved because the dSYM cache eviction job ran during peak upload. Alerts fired correctly; on-call acknowledged within four minutes. Mitigation: paused the eviction job and scaled symbolication workers from 6 to 14. Lag recovered by 15:10. No reports were dropped. The affected pipeline run can be identified by the token below.

pipeline stamp: htk9_ce63042d9

## Service Accounts — StormFan Alert Fan-Out

The fan-out worker authenticates to the internal dispatch tier using the svc-stormfan account. Rotate quarterly; scopes are limited to publish-only on alert topics. If deliveries stall during your shift, verify the worker is using the current credential, reproduced below for reference.

API key for kaweg-hahif: kto4_rAjZ

Handover note — Crumbwheel order cutoffs.

Welcome aboard. The bakery cutoff rule in Crumbwheel closes same-day orders at 14:00 local to each storefront, not UTC — this has bitten us twice. Holiday overrides live in the calendar service and take precedence silently, so always check there first when a cutoff looks wrong. To unlock the calendar service's admin console after a restart, enter the recovery passphrase below.

vault phrase of bagap-bahaf = silion-pelox-sorox-casdor-quenwyn-fraax-eliox-praael-kelion-quenvan-kasox-rusael-norius-belvan